PgcDemux |
An alternative to VobEdit, PgcDemux demuxes a DVD/VOB,IFO (PGC) in its elementary streams, video(m2v), audio(ac3,wav,dts,mpa) and subtitles(sup).

Handy little tool to split VOB's into fundamental streams--audio, video and subtitles. From there you can convert the video, audio and edit the subtitles. Rejig reauthors everything back togther (NTSC) or try IFOEdit. VOBEdit had problems with the time stamps for the subtitles, PGCDemux solved this problem.
